The Crumlin United Ladies Team is managed by Brian Tennyson and Matt Shortt. We play in Division 3 of the NIWFA.
We train on Wednesdays (19:30) at the Community Centre - new members always welcome.

Crumlin Ladies lose to League Leaders
CUFC Ladies 0 - 4 Valley Rangers
CUFC Ladies went to Binian Park with high expectations of an upset, but instead they left just upset. The table topping Valley Rangers have been scoring goals for fun of late, even putting 11 past one unfortunate side in recent weeks, so no shame in the result last week.
Next up is another tough challenge from the league's second place team, Portadown. This game will be played at the Antrim Forum, as the Mill Road pitch has just underwent some significant (and much needed) remedial work.

Crumlin Ladies soundly beat Ballynahinch
CUFC Ladies 6 - 1 Ballynahinch Olympic
CUFC Ladies soundly beat the visitors from Ballynahinch. A hattrick from the Division's joint top scorer, Anna McBride and contributions from Masterson, Doherty and Scannell put the team into third place in the league. With another home game on Wednesday night against Rossglass County (currently winless), the girls can take a great stride towards that top spot.
